Multan Student Ends Life After Exam Result Disappointment

Last updated: August 22, 2025 4:25 am
Hamza baig
Share
SHARE

A ninth-grade student took his own life in Mohalla Lal Shahi after receiving low marks in his board results.

According to police reported by Dunya News, the student, identified as Muhammad Bilal, consumed poisonous tablets in despair over his exam performance. He was shifted to Nishtar Hospital, where he later succumbed during treatment.

Police from Makhdoom Rasheed station have initiated further investigation into the incident.
